Lockport High School continues to create new opportunities for their students to help them in the real world. Most recently, LTHS has partnered with the Will County Center for Economic Development to provide students with the chance to apply for a paid summer internship.
These internships will provide students with valuable firsthand work experience and will help them build their resume. The opportunities cover a multitude of career options from childcare to marketing.

As a student, we want to know the benefits of the program over others, and Sorenson promised, “The Will County Summer Internship Program provides high school students with invaluable real-world experience that helps shape their career paths. Through this program, students gain:
- Hands-On Experience: Interns work directly with local businesses.
- Career Exploration: Exposure to different industries allows students to discover potential career interests and gain clarity on their future goals.
- Resume Building: A structured, paid internship enhances students’ resumes, making them more competitive for future job and college applications.
- Professional Development: Students gain critical workplace skills such as communication, teamwork, problem-solving, and time management.
- Networking Opportunities: By building relationships with local professionals, students establish connections that could lead to future job opportunities and mentorship.
- Community Engagement: The program encourages students to invest in their local economy, fostering a sense of pride in Will County and providing a compelling reason to build their futures here.
This program is designed to be more than just a summer job—it’s a launchpad for students to develop their potential and take their first steps toward meaningful careers all while supporting our local businesses and their need for a strong, educated workforce.”
